The Future of Agriculture with Nutrient Recycling

Nutrient recycling is at the heart of EkoBalans’ work to create a sustainable and circular agricultural system. In a world where resources are becoming increasingly limited, we offer innovative solutions to recycle essential nutrients such as nitrogen and phosphorus from wastewater, industrial by-products, and organic waste. By capturing these nutrients and reintroducing them into agriculture, we can reduce dependence on synthetic fertilizers and promote more sustainable use of the Earth’s resources.

Our Methods

Our advanced technologies for nutrient recycling include a range of processes, such as chemical precipitation, biological purification, and innovative filtration systems. These methods enable the effective extraction of nutrients from various types of waste streams, allowing them to be reused as high-quality fertilizers. This not only helps close nutrient cycles but also reduces the risk of water source pollution due to nutrient runoff.

Benefits

Recycling nutrients offers many environmental and agricultural benefits. It reduces the need for mining and industrial production of fertilizers, which in turn decreases carbon emissions and energy consumption. Additionally, it helps reduce nutrient runoff that causes eutrophication in water bodies. Our solutions provide farmers with access to affordable, effective, and environmentally friendly fertilizers that enhance crop yields and soil health without harming the environment.
